NVIDIA GeForce GTX 770 vs Intel Arc B580

We compared two Desktop platform GPUs: 2GB VRAM GeForce GTX 770 and 12GB VRAM Arc B580 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

Intel Arc B580 's Advantages
Released 11 years and 7 months late
Boost Clock has increased by 146% (2670MHz vs 1085MHz)
More VRAM (12GB vs 2GB)
Larger VRAM bandwidth (456.0GB/s vs 224.4GB/s)
1024 additional rendering cores
Lower TDP (190W vs 230W)
